Output 204f519827b8397c18f040a473a69b56122a7ecb28621036ff8a90a5a2afc1b2:44

value
358756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83e24548a5978bfbd0edb86067255c90ed15826 OP_EQUAL
address
3MQQKg7CHEa75bVbCTNnzKbsodhTyuiGQr
transaction
204f519827b8397c18f040a473a69b56122a7ecb28621036ff8a90a5a2afc1b2
spent
true